python之求最小公倍数
# -*- coding: UTF-8 -*- # 题目描述 # 正整数A和正整数B 的最小公倍数是指 能被A和B整除的最小的正整数值,设计一个算法,求输入A和B的最小公倍数。 # 输入描述: # 输入两个正整数A和B。 # 输出描述: # 输出A和B的最小公倍数。 # 示例1 # 输入 # # 5 7 # 输出 # # 35 # 求最小公倍数 def getNum(m, n):list1 = []a, b = 0, 0for i in range(2, min(m, n) + 1):if m % i == 0 and n % i == 0:m = m / in = n / ia, b = m, nlist1.append(str(i))print(eval("*".join(list1)) * int(a) * int(b))getNum(7, 14)# 方案二 m, n = map(int, raw_input().split()) a = m b = n t = 0 while n != 0:t = mm = nn = t % n print(a * b) / m# 方案三 row = raw_input().split() a = int(row[0]) b = int(row[1])def gcd(m, n):while m != 0:m, n = n % m, mreturn nc = a * b print c / gcd(a, b)
python之求最小公倍数相关推荐
- python辗转相除法求最小公倍数_Python实现利用最大公约数求三个正整数的最小公倍数示例...
Python实现利用最大公约数求三个正整数的最小公倍数示例 本文实例讲述了Python实现利用最大公约数求三个正整数的最小公倍数.分享给大家供大家参考,具体如下: 在求解两个数的小公倍数的方法时,假设 ...
- python函数编程求三个数的最小公倍数_Python求三个数的最小公倍数
题目 求三个数的最小公倍数 思路 首先求两个数的最小公倍数,再求这个最小公倍数与第三个数的最小公倍数就是最终结果 有两种方案求两个数的最小公倍数 1. 分解质因数,也是短除法(在程序上差别不大) 循环 ...
- python求最小公倍数_python求最大公约数和最小公倍数的简单方法
python怎么求最大公约数和最小公倍数 一.求最大公约数 用辗转相除法求最大公约数的算法如下: 两个正整数a和b(a>b),它们的最大公约数等于a除以b的余数c和b之间的最大公约数.比如10和 ...
- Python程序:求最小公倍数
Python程序:求最小公倍数 --摘自远山启<数学与生活>第二版 1.大数倍数法 2.利用最大公约数 两个整数的乘积除以它们的最大公约数,就是它们的最小公倍数. Python的math模 ...
- python中求最小公约数,python求最大公约数和最小公倍数的简单方法
python求最大公约数和最小公倍数的简单方法 python怎么求最大公约数和最小公倍数 一.求最大公约数 用辗转相除法求最大公约数的算法如下: 两个正整数a和b(a>b),它们的最大公约数等于 ...
- python练习题(python之“求一个数的阶乘并求结果中从后向前数第一个不为0(零)的数” 等)
实验环境:python2.7 题目1:python之"求一个数的阶乘并求结果中从后向前数第一个不为0(零)的数" 程序: import math def factorial(n): ...
- python函数def里面嵌套def,python菜鸟求问关于嵌套函数中作用域范围应该怎么理解?,python嵌套,直接上代码def l(l...
python菜鸟求问关于嵌套函数中作用域范围应该怎么理解?,python嵌套,直接上代码def l(l 直接上代码def l(list): def d(): return list return d ...
- python concat函数 多张表_教你用python递归函数求n的阶乘,优缺点及递归次数设置方式
本文内容介绍了python递归函数求n的阶乘,优缺点及递归次数设置方式,具有很好的参考价值,希望对大家有所帮助.一起跟随小编过来看看吧! 递归函数两大特点: 1.能够调用函数自身 2.至少有一个出口( ...
- 常见算法:C语言求最小公倍数和最大公约数三种算法
最小公倍数:数论中的一种概念,两个整数公有的倍数成为他们的公倍数,当中一个最小的公倍数是他们的最小公倍数,相同地,若干个整数公有的倍数中最小的正整数称为它们的最小公倍数,维基百科:定义点击打开链接 求 ...
最新文章
- potainer 日志_实时Web日志分析神器
- php ×××号码效验码生成函数
- vsxxxx Avalon 感知提示
- linux中用截取一些信息,Linux如何使用cut命令截取文件信息
- 深度学习机器学习大牛
- vue.config.js配置
- php中$_get和$_post如何使用,怎么使用超级全局变量$_POST与$_GET
- 文件上传java前端怎么写_做一个文件上传,前端是ajax提交数据后台是java,这个错误怎么办...
- 微服务链路追踪_.NET Core微服务:分布式链路追踪系统分享
- 集合类和JAVA多线程
- 845透色android10,骁龙845旗舰宝刀不老 升级安卓10焕然一新
- Nginx核心原理揭秘:Nginx为什么高效?
- EPM240T100的Pin
- IDEA配置安卓环境
- npy文件的保存与读取
- 一款给变量自动取名的工具
- 网络安全之木马的工作原理及其攻击步骤
- 营销:uplift模型
- 电子印章有哪些特点和优势?
- alc236黑苹果驱动_黑苹果亮度调节及调节快捷键驱动
热门文章
- rs_D455相机内外参标定+imu联合标定
- matlab 颗粒碰撞,Lsdyna颗粒碰撞图 - 仿真模拟 - 小木虫 - 学术 科研 互动社区
- html监控页面大小,JQuery实时监控窗口大小(无需插件)
- 【JZOJ 5426】【NOIP2017提高A组集训10.25】摘Galo
- 一个mybatis动态 SQL查询的完整小案例。包含多表联合查询。
- CE-扫描扫雷中雷区地址
- JavaScript大作业 (校园运动会网站设计与实现)
- 实现点击图片放大查看功能
- 【XSY3490】线段树(广义线段树,树上莫队)
- Excel绘制带象限散点图的4种办法